DFT的matlab源代码FPGA_AudioVisualizer 用于高效且可扩展的DFT计算器的Verilog代码(使用FFT算法)。 打算在Intel DE10-Lite FPGA开发板上实现。 从外部麦克风读取音频数据,并在VGA监视器上显示频率分量。 该项目的灵感来自于Kenny Chan的同名仓库(@ kennych418),来自麦克风转换器和VGA发生器的Verilog部分直接来自他的项目。 FFT处理器的体系结构是从纸上得出的。 跑步 创建一个新的Quartus项目,选择您要使用的设备,并将此存储库中的文件(此自述文件除外)导入该项目。 单击分配->设备,然后单击设备和引脚选项。 选择左侧的“配置”选项,对于“配置”模式,选择“带有内存初始化的单个未压缩映像”。 打开twiddle_script.py文件和编辑DATA_WIDTH你将在FFT计算承载的比特数,并编辑addr_width登录2(S),其中S是要采取的样本数量。 在您的项目文件夹中运行此脚本将生成rom_r_init.txt和rom_i_init.txt ,它们用于初始化ROM,这些ROM保留用于FFT计算
2021-06-30 22:28:38 19KB 系统开源
1
视频编码与通信第一次大作业,对一张图片进行DFT和DCT的正反变换(不使用自带函数);分块作8x8的2D-DCT变换并保留左上角六条对角线上的系数。
2021-06-30 22:04:30 1.81MB Matlab DCT DFT 2D-DCT
水印的嵌入与提取 fft()实现一维信号和二维信号的FFT(快速傅里叶变换),ifft()分别实现一维信号和二维信号的IFFT(逆向快速傅里叶变换)。下面以256×256 的灰度图像lena 为原始宿主图像、以32×32 的二值图像flag 为水印图像为例,给出利用MATLAB 实现数字水印的过程。 水印攻击实验 由于数字水印在实际应用中可能会遭到各种各样的攻击,因此对算法进行攻击测试是衡量一个水印算法优劣的重要手段。 JPEG 压缩实验 首先对嵌入水印后的图像进行JPEG(Quality=45),而后从压缩的图像中提取出水印,如图5 所示。从图中可以看到DCT 域的水印算法抵抗JPEG 压缩攻击的效果是比较好的。imwrite()函数中的jpg 和quality 参数能对图像进行可控jpg压缩 噪声实验 加入噪声是对水印鲁棒性考验的一种常见的攻击。本实验是在嵌入水印的图像中分别加入均值为0,方差为0.002 的高斯噪声和强度为0.02 的椒盐噪声,并从中提取水印,如图6 所示。imnoise()函数可以对图像加入各种噪声,如白噪声、椒盐噪声等 结论 嵌入水印信息后,原图与嵌入水印信息后的图像在视觉效果上没有明显分别,用肉眼几乎分辨不出,这说明这种算法充分利用了人眼的视觉HVS 特性,利用FFT域嵌入水印后,水印的不可见性相当好,图像在嵌入水印前后视觉效果改变不大,不影响图像的正常使用。从图5 可明显看出:嵌入水印后的图像经过参数"Quality"为"45"的JPEG 压缩后,还能从中提取出水印且非常清晰;对含水印的图像进行方差为0.002 的高斯噪声攻击后,加入水印后的图像已经模糊,但是提取出的水印仍清晰可辩。以上实验证实了这种嵌入算法的抗攻击性较好,而且检测和提取易于实现。
2021-06-28 23:29:51 223KB 数字水印 灰度图像 DFT
1
DFT的matlab源代码数字信号处理理论与应用 实验1简单采样和光谱 用Matlab进行非常简单的信号处理。 实验2简单过滤 过滤器特性。 卷积的实现。 离散傅立叶变换。 使用Overlapp-add和Overlapp-save使用DFT进行循环卷积和长序列过滤。 实验3 IIR和FIR滤波器设计 脉冲不变变换。 双线性变换。 具有指定规格的椭圆,巴特沃斯,切比雪夫1和切比雪夫2过滤器的设计。 窗口过滤器设计。 Park McClellan方法。 实验4有限字长 固定点表示转换。 实验5多速率DSP 多速率系统设计。 作者 路德维希·特兰赫登(Ludwig Tranheden)
2021-06-28 12:25:37 16KB 系统开源
1
DFTAdvisor Reference Manual 为了让大家都找得到免费的学习资料,特此免费免积分下载,为我国IC行业的发展贡献绵薄之力。文件不是很清晰,但是看得清楚,多多包涵。
2021-06-25 12:03:08 20.98MB DFTAdvisor DFT 数字后端
1
数字系统测试与可测性设计实验指导书ATPG应用 为了让大家都找得到免费的学习资料,特此免费免积分下载,为我国IC行业的发展贡献绵薄之力。文件不是很清晰,但是看得清楚,多多包涵。
1
有限长序列的补零DFT运算,理论推导,程序代码及截图
2021-06-20 13:46:07 36KB 序列补零DFT
1
根据实例进行经典谱估计,估计f1和f2,画出原图与mse最小均方误差的图。 某大学,陈老师的随机信号课程,大作业。内附代码加图片,十分清晰,可供参考,有需要请下载,谢谢。
1
DFT的matlab源代码结合了DFT和DT-CWT域的彩色图像鲁棒数字水印 该存储库提供以下论文的测试代码。 引文: Q. Ying,L。Lin,Z。Qian,H。Xu和X. Zhang,DFT和DT-CWT组合域中彩色图像的鲁棒数字水印,数学生物科学与工程,16(5):4788–4801, 2019。 PDF可在以下位置找到: 希望您可以引用本文以改善引用。 摘要:图像水印的重点是将秘密数据隐蔽地隐藏在封面图像中,以保护原始图像的版权。 在本文中,我们提出了一种使用离散傅里叶变换(DFT)和对偶树复数小波变换(DTCWT)的结合嵌入技术的彩色图像数字水印方案。 封面图像首先分为Y,U和V通道。 然后,通过DFT转换Y通道,并将其划分为环形。 使用嵌入密钥,我们生成伪随机模式来表示水印。 这些模式也被转换和划分。 然后,由模式选择表示的水印被嵌入到DFT系数的环中。 我们进一步在U通道中嵌入了整流水印,在D通道中应用DTCWT来实现几何失真复原能力。 在接收方,水印的检测和提取可以成功完成。
2021-06-18 12:56:42 73KB 系统开源
1
SOC芯片与DFT
2021-06-12 09:01:32 1.97MB soc
1